Ranks, or Reputation, is a reflection of how a faction views you. A sufficiently negative reputation means that the faction in question considers you an enemy, will attempt to kill you on sight and is usually marked with red reticules and sector map markers for your visual convenience.
Each rank requires roughly 3 times the points to advance. For each rank you gain, you must do 3 times the work, or do things worth 3 times the notability. Each step is (more or less) geometrically harder than the last.
An “L” displayed in-game after the race's rank indicated the player owns a police license for that faction.
